Balochistan — worst drought-hit province

By: Mohammad Jamil PAKISTAN is facing water shortage in all the provinces because during the last thirty years no new large water reservoir has been built. However Balochistan is the worst drought-hit province, as water sources in Balochistan have been contaminated due to low rainfalls in Balochistan particularly in Awaran district, resulting in water borne diseases and deaths. Allauddin Marri selected as caretaker CM of Balochistan

ISLAMABAD: The Election Commission of Pakistan has selected Alauddin Marri to be the caretaker chief minister of Balochistan. ECP Additional Secretary Akhtar Nazir made the announcement at a press conference outside the commission’s office in Islamabad.
